titleOfInvention Electrochemical cell
abstract Electrochemical cell array for the treatment of a sample via electro-(end-)osmotic flow, comprisingn (i) an electrode chamber, comprising a cathodic compartment (CC) and an anodic compartment (AC), (ii) a cathode (C), being arranged in the cathodic compartment (CC), (iii) an anode (A), being arranged in the anodic compartment (AC), (iv) an intermediate cathodic compartment (C 1 ) (v) an intermediate anodic compartment (A 1 ) (iv) a first selective membrane (M 1 ) being arranged between said cathodic compartment (CC) and said first intermediate cathodic compartment (C 1 ) (v) a second selective membrane (M 2 ) being arranged between said anodic compartment (AC) and said first intermediate anodic compartment (A 1 ) (vi) a treatment compartment (T) for the sample being arranged between said intermediate cathodic compartment (C 1 ) and said intermediate anodic compartment (A 1 ), further comprising a first separator membrane (S 1 ) between said treatment compartment (T) and said intermediate cathodic compartment (C 1 ) and a second separator membrane (S 2 ) arranged between said treatment compartment (T) and said intermediate anodic compartment (A 1 ).
